Foundation Drain Replacement in Birmingham, AL
Foundation drain replacement is a service that involves removing and installing new drainage systems around a property's foundation to help manage water flow and prevent moisture buildup. This process is often necessary when existing drains become clogged, damaged, or ineffective, leading to issues such as basement flooding, foundation shifting, or structural damage. Projects typically include excavating around the foundation, removing old or broken drains, and installing new, properly functioning drain pipes designed to direct water away from the foundation for improved stability and dryness.
Homeowners considering foundation drain replacement should understand that the service is essential for addressing persistent basement moisture problems, drainage concerns, or signs of foundation movement. It’s important to evaluate the current state of the drainage system, the extent of any water-related issues, and whether the existing drains are functioning properly. Proper installation and drainage design are key factors in ensuring long-term protection against water intrusion and foundation damage, making it a vital step for maintaining the integrity of a home’s structure.

Foundation Drain Replacement Questions
What is a foundation drain replacement? It involves removing and installing new drainage systems around a building's foundation to prevent water buildup and foundation damage.
When should a foundation drain be replaced? Replacement is recommended if existing drains are clogged, damaged, or no longer effectively divert water away from the foundation.
What are common signs that indicate drain replacement is needed? Indicators include persistent basement flooding, damp or moldy walls, and visible water pooling near the foundation.
How does replacing a foundation drain benefit a property? It helps protect the foundation from water damage, reduces the risk of structural issues, and promotes a dry, stable basement environment.
